[cobirds] Bird Conservancy of the Rockies - Western Slope Banding Station Report- Sept. 30-Oct. 4, 2024

Aside from the unseasonably warm temperatures, our third week of banding at Connected Lakes State Park has us comfortably transitioning into a typical autumn, desert/riparian corridor banding station. We're still seeing a trickle of warbler migration in the form of Wilson's and Orange-crowned Warblers. But unless we are catching an entire flock of Bushtits or White-crowned Sparrows, the net runs have been slow and steady.

You can find our banded species listed below. And if you are interested in additional species we saw at the park last week, you can check out our eBird trip report for the week. https://ebird.org/tripreport/280863

Black-capped Chickadee - 1 new, 4 repeat recapture
Bushtit - 16 new
Ruby-crowned Kinglet - 2 new
Blue-gray Gnatcatcher - 1 new
Bewicks's Wren - 1 repeat recapture
Mountain White-crowned Sparrow - 8 new
Gambel's White-crowned Sparrow - 29 new, 4 repeat recapture
Song Sparrow - 4 new
Orange-crowned Warbler - 1 new
Spotted Towhee - 3 new, 1 return recapture (HY - 2021)
Wilson's Warbler - 6 new, 2 repeat recaptures
